MANCHESTER’S biggest Indoor Christmas attraction, the award-winning Winter Wonderland Manchester is back for 2017!

The magic of Christmas will take over EventCity next to the Intu Trafford Centre from Saturday 9th December 2017 to Monday 1st January 2018.

Legendary children’s TV show, Rainbow will be the star attraction of this year’s Christmas extravaganza, plus over 50 family rides and attractions all under one roof – including new rides for 2017, and all included in one ticket price.

As well as the rides and the bright lights, there will be a dazzling array of colourful shows which this year includes Zippy and George from Rainbow who will no doubt bring lots of magic, mayhem and comedy capers!

The spectacular Christmas Circus also makes a welcome return delivering the finest collection of circus acts that will leave everyone marvelled and amazed with daily performances.

Of course, Christmas wouldn’t be Christmas without a visit from Santa Claus complete with real reindeers, who will be taking time out of his busy schedule for meet and greets with all the children, every day up to and including Christmas Eve. Fairies and Elves will also fly around to play and chat and have ‘s-elfies’ with the children.

There will also be a whole host of games stalls and a vast array of food and drinks stalls to purchase refreshments including hot snacks and sweet treats.

Winter Wonderland operates on a session basis to ensure visitors can enjoy the experience without overcrowding offering families four hours of non-stop fun and entertainment.
